Great Linford was one of the North Buckinghamshire villages incorporated into Milton Keynes at its designation in 1967. The origin of the name Linford is not recorded. The first reference to Linford occurs in 944, when "King Edmund gave to his thegn Aelfheah, land at Linforda with liberty to leave it to whom he wished"; it appears in the Domesday Book as Linforda. WebSP 84 SW GREAT LINFORD WOOD LANE 2/49 Linford Lodge. 28.8.75 II House, used as Restaurant. C18, incorporating earlier fabric, altered. Rubble stone, old tiles to S. wing, pantiles to E. wing;brick chimneys, L shaped plan. 2 storeys and attic.
